Car boot sale organized by the Barbazan-Debat football club in Hautes-Pyrénées
The Football Club car boot sale is organized each year by the Association Sportive et Culturelle de Barbazan (ASCB), the local football club of Barbazan-Debat. This autumn event brings together residents of this residential suburb south of Tarbes for great deals and a convivial moment. The proceeds help fund the club's operations, equipment purchases and team travel.
ASCB (Association Sportive et Culturelle de Barbazan) is the football club of Barbazan-Debat, affiliated with the Hautes-Pyrénées football district. Each autumn, the club organizes a large car boot sale to fund its sporting activities. Exhibitors, both private individuals and associations, offer clothing, toys, books, crockery and everyday items at bargain prices.
Barbazan-Debat is a commune of around 3,500 inhabitants located immediately south of Tarbes, in the Adour valley. This residential village offers a pleasant living environment between the proximity of Tarbes' urban services and the tranquility of green surroundings facing the first Pyrenean foothills. The football club helps enliven local community life with its youth and senior teams, and this car boot sale has become an eagerly awaited back-to-school event.
